Try to follow these steps

  1. install JDK and set JAVA_HOME environment variable
  2. Refer this answer to know how to get and install certificate into cacerts
  3. You need to Get Root CA certificate of your network.
  4. You need to install that certificate into cacerts file
  5. Restart eclipse
